Chinley to Dorchester West by train

A train trip from Chinley to Dorchester West takes about 7hrs 30 mins on average, covering roughly 183 miles (294 kilometres). With around 7 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£35.50,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Chinley to Dorchester West start from as little as £35.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Chinley to Dorchester West start from £176.50 one way, or £182.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Chinley to Dorchester West are available for £174.80 one way, or £349.40 return

Facilities and Accessibility

Chinley station, while maintaining an understated presence, doesn’t shy away from providing essential services. Though it lacks a ticket office, there are ticket machines available for those needing to collect pre-purchased tickets. However, it's imperative to note there are no accessible ticket machines. Smartcards are issued here, though you'll have to validate them elsewhere as validators aren't present. Do you need to speak to someone for aid? Staff assistance is absent, but helplines and help points on platforms ensure you aren’t left in a lurch.

In terms of accessibility, Chinley is a Category C station, indicating limited accessibility. There’s no step-free access across the footbridge which leads to the island platform. Nevertheless, there are ramps available for train access, allowing some level of assistance for travelers with mobility needs. While the station lacks facilities such as waiting rooms or accessible toilets, there is seating available to make your wait more comfortable.

Exploring Onward Travel Options

While getting to and from Chinley station, you have a modest selection of transport choices. A rail replacement service picks up and drops off at the station entrance on Station Road when needed, ensuring continuous travel even during disruptions. For those seeking taxi services, options are listed conveniently on Northern Railway's cab page, making your onward travel from Chinley seamless. Additionally, public buses can be accessed with ease; further info is just a phone call away at Busline 0871 200 2233. Although bicycle hire is unavailable at the station, there are cycling storages for those arriving on two wheels.

Facilities and Amenities

While Dorchester West station might be modest in size, it has a wealth of essential features. However, travelers should note that there is no ticket office or machines on site, so it's wise to purchase your tickets in advance online. An induction loop is present to aid those who are hearing impaired. For those needing assistance, helpful staff can be reached via a dedicated help point. Although there are no dedicated facilities for waiting or shopping, there's a seating area where you can rest while waiting for your train. CCTV is operational, ensuring your safety during your visit.

Access and Assistance

Accessibility at Dorchester West station is quite accommodating although there are limitations. The platforms provide step-free access through public footpaths, though transitioning between platforms via the footbridge involves stairs. However, a ramp is available for train access, allowing ease for those with mobility needs. It's worth mentioning that no accessible taxis or designated set-down/pick-up points are present, so planning your journey with these considerations in mind is important.
